titleOfInvention Composition for complex therapy of intoxications in animals
abstract FIELD: medicine, veterinary medicine. n SUBSTANCE: invention relates to pharmacology, particularly compositions for complex therapy of intoxications and critical states in animals. The complex therapy composition for intoxications in animals contains: glucose, succinic and ascorbic acids, sodium and calcium chlorides, sodium hydroxide, and distilled water, in following proportion of ingredients: 250 g glucose, 10 g succinic acid, 2 g ascorbic acid, 7 g sodium chloride, 2 g calcium chloride, 10 g sodium hydroxide, and distilled water to 1000 ml, solution pH = 6.3 to 6.4. n EFFECT: provides high anti-hypoxic and anti-oxidant activity of the composition in therapy for intoxications and critical states of various etiologies. n 2 tbl, 1 ex
